Let's take a look at the blurb:

FOR MAGIC. FOR MEMORY. FOR EACH OTHER.

Mortal mage Henley Yu has enough to worry about between the storms caused by broken magic and his strained relationship with his father. He’s trying to keep his head above water, but when he finds a stranger hiding in his kitchen cabinets he’s forced to reconsider his priorities.

Chief Operator Kittinger has overseen the flow of magic for centuries, but he’s no fighter. Betrayed by his protectors in their quest to gain control of the magic, he’s running for his life when he makes Henley his accomplice. Kit might lose his new ally if Henley finds out that Kit’s secrets go deeper than the magic itself.

Together they’ll venture into the Between, where magic connects worlds, to fight an army of officers ready to finish what they started when Kit fled the scene. For Kit, failure means death. For Henley, it means losing the memory of the only person who gives him purpose. Henley won’t let anyone interfere before he finds out what that means for their future together.

He’ll save Kit. He'll save the magic—or he won’t be the only one who dies trying.

Christina K. Glover

Christina K. Glover

Christina K. Glover (she/her) is an accountant determined to prove that crunching numbers doesn’t crunch creativity. She lives in Houston, TX with her family, including two incredible housemates and a menagerie of pets. Her bucket list items are learning Japanese/visiting Japan, learning to pick locks, and flying in a hot air balloon. When not writing she can be found buried in a pile of manga or playing phone games (Stardew Valley, anyone?) long past her bedtime.
